What is Zimbra OSE?
Zimbra OSE (Open Source Edition) is a free and open-source email and collaboration platform that provides a robust and scalable solution for managing email, contacts, calendar, and tasks. It is designed to be highly customizable and extensible, making it a popular choice among developers and system administrators. With its modular architecture, Zimbra OSE allows users to easily integrate third-party applications and services, enhancing its functionality and capabilities.
Main Features of Zimbra OSE
Zimbra OSE offers a wide range of features that make it an attractive solution for email and collaboration needs. Some of its key features include:
- Web-based interface for easy access and management
- Support for multiple email protocols, including IMAP, POP, and SMTP
- Calendar and task management with reminders and notifications
- Contact management with address book and sharing capabilities
- File sharing and collaboration tools
Installation Guide
System Requirements
Before installing Zimbra OSE, ensure that your system meets the following requirements:
- Operating System: 64-bit Linux distribution (e.g., Ubuntu, CentOS, RHEL)
- Processor: 2 GHz dual-core or higher
- Memory: 8 GB RAM or higher
- Storage: 20 GB free disk space or higher
Installation Steps
Follow these steps to install Zimbra OSE:
- Download the Zimbra OSE installation package from the official website
- Extract the package and navigate to the installation directory
- Run the installation script using the command ./install.sh
-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ation
Technical Specifications
Architecture
Zimbra OSE is built on a modular architecture, consisting of several components that work together to provide its functionality:
| Component | Description |
|---|---|
| Mailbox Server | Handles email storage and retrieval |
| LDAP Server | Manages user authentication and directory services |
| Web Server | Provides web-based access to email and collaboration features |
